Transaction 8ecf82fc7507723a2445c5af6c25d92268aaf4be37ed2fb1df8126c9db470713
1 Input
1 Output
-
8ecf82fc7507723a2445c5af6c25d92268aaf4be37ed2fb1df8126c9db470713:0
- value
- 126600
- script pubkey
- OP_0 OP_PUSHBYTES_20 537a5d8c2c0cc4be2bafe6f13955e0b799d6924a
- address
- bc1q2da9mrpvpnztu2a0umcnj40qk7vadyj29z7ntv